The ERC=Science² project, funded by the European Research Council (ERC), engaged hundreds of Latvians at Curiosity centre ZINOO. In the framework of the project, LASC has organised a series of events called “Music and Sound” in Cesis, Latvia. Workshops, and dialogue activities, as well as a concert and visits to the ERC=Science2 stand were some of the strategies used to approach people to ERC grantees’ research projects.

On 3 November 2018, as part of the ERC= Science2 project, ERC Grantee Dr Michael Ellison from the University of Bristol, will talk about music, culture and theatre at Ellinogermaniki Agogi in Pallini, Greece. His presentation “Towards a Transcultural Music and Transcultural Musical Theatre” will be one of the keynote speeches of the national conference for teachers organised by EA.
